Paradise Hills: A Scenic Southeast San Diego Neighborhood with Strong Community Roots

A Hillside Community Overlooking San Diego Bay

Paradise Hills in San Diego, California is a residential neighborhood located in the southeastern part of the city, known for its elevated views, suburban streets, and strong sense of community identity. The neighborhood sits on rolling hills overlooking parts of San Diego Bay, National City, and surrounding South Bay communities, giving many homes scenic vistas and a distinct hillside character.

Paradise Hills is primarily made up of single-family homes, small apartment complexes, and community-oriented spaces. It is a diverse neighborhood where families, long-term residents, and working professionals live in a relatively quiet suburban setting while still having access to urban amenities nearby. Its location near major roads and neighboring districts makes it both peaceful and well connected.

History and Development of Paradise Hills

Paradise Hills began developing in the mid-20th century during San Diego’s suburban expansion. As the city grew outward from its urban core, hillside land in Southeast San Diego was gradually transformed into residential communities designed for families seeking more space and affordability.

The neighborhood’s development accelerated after World War II, when housing demand increased across Southern California. Developers built modest homes across the hillsides, taking advantage of natural elevation and available land. Over time, Paradise Hills became one of the key residential areas in Southeast San Diego.

The community has also been shaped by demographic shifts, becoming home to a diverse population including Latino, African American, Asian, and immigrant families. This diversity has contributed to a strong cultural identity and active community life.

Roads and Transportation in Paradise Hills

Paradise Hills is connected by several major and local roads that make commuting and travel convenient. Paradise Valley Road is one of the most important corridors, running through the neighborhood and connecting residents to National City, Bonita, and surrounding areas.

Reo Drive and Meadowbrook Drive serve as key internal roads, linking residential sections and providing access to schools, parks, and shopping areas. These streets are generally quiet and residential, reinforcing the neighborhood’s suburban feel.

Nearby major highways such as Interstate 805 and State Route 54 provide regional access to downtown San Diego, Chula Vista, and other parts of the county. These freeways make Paradise Hills well connected despite its hillside location.

Public transportation is also available, with bus routes serving major corridors and connecting residents to transit hubs in South Bay and central San Diego.

Parks and Outdoor Spaces in Paradise Hills

Paradise Hills offers several parks and recreational spaces that are central to community life.

Paradise Hills Community Park is the main recreational hub in the neighborhood. It features sports fields, playgrounds, walking paths, and open green areas used for community events and family activities.

South Bay Recreation Center and nearby parks in adjacent neighborhoods also provide additional space for sports, fitness, and outdoor gatherings.

The neighborhood’s hillside geography also allows for scenic walking areas and residential views, making outdoor activity a natural part of daily life.

Things to Do in Paradise Hills

Paradise Hills offers a calm lifestyle centered around local parks, community events, and nearby urban amenities.

Residents frequently use Paradise Hills Community Park for sports, walking, and family gatherings. Youth leagues and seasonal community events are common throughout the year.

Nearby shopping and dining options are available in National City, Chula Vista, and along major corridors such as Plaza Boulevard and Palm Avenue. These areas provide restaurants, grocery stores, and entertainment options within a short drive.

Residents also travel to South Bay beaches, downtown San Diego, and waterfront areas for recreation and leisure activities, making Paradise Hills a convenient base for regional exploration.

Government and Public Services

Paradise Hills falls under the jurisdiction of the City of San Diego and is part of its southeastern planning and service districts. Municipal services include infrastructure maintenance, public safety, zoning, and community development programs.

The San Diego Police Department provides law enforcement services to the area, focusing on residential safety and community engagement. Fire and emergency medical services are also accessible due to the neighborhood’s proximity to major roads and highways.

City initiatives in Paradise Hills often focus on infrastructure improvements, park maintenance, youth programs, and supporting neighborhood development across Southeast San Diego.

Education and Schools in Paradise Hills

Paradise Hills is served by the San Diego Unified School District, with several elementary, middle, and high schools located in and around the neighborhood.

Schools in the area serve a diverse student population and often provide bilingual education and community support programs. After-school activities and local nonprofit initiatives help support student development and engagement.

The presence of accessible schools makes Paradise Hills a practical choice for families seeking affordable housing within San Diego city limits.

Housing and Neighborhood Character

Housing in Paradise Hills consists primarily of single-family homes built on hillside lots, along with apartment complexes and duplexes. Many homes were constructed during the mid-20th century suburban expansion and have since been renovated or updated.

The neighborhood is known for its elevated views, with many homes overlooking surrounding valleys, the bay, and nearby cityscapes. Streets are generally quiet, and residential life is a defining feature of the area.

Paradise Hills remains one of the more affordable residential neighborhoods in San Diego, making it attractive to families and long-term residents.

Community Identity and Lifestyle

Paradise Hills is defined by its strong community ties, cultural diversity, and residential stability. It is a neighborhood where families often stay for many years, building long-term connections with neighbors and local institutions.

Despite being part of a larger urban region, Paradise Hills maintains a quieter, suburban feel with a strong emphasis on community pride and local engagement.

Final Overview of Paradise Hills

Paradise Hills stands as a scenic and diverse hillside neighborhood in Southeast San Diego. Its history reflects suburban expansion, while its present is shaped by strong community identity, affordability, and residential comfort.

With parks, schools, churches, and convenient access to South Bay and central San Diego, Paradise Hills continues to be a stable and desirable place to live within the city.
